Noise Pollution Reduced
Double glazing can help reduce noise pollution in your home, especially if it is near a road or flight route. This is because double glazed windows are made up of two glass panes and an air gap between them, creating an effective sound barrier. Another benefit of luton's double glazing is that it helps to reduce condensation in your home. The humid air is drawn to cooler surfaces and causes them to get clumped together and show up as condensation on window panes shower doors,, or bathroom mirrors. This could cause mildew to develop, giving your home an unpleasant odor and harming your woodwork. Double glazing is a solution to this issue, since it is able to separate warm air inside your home from cold air outside. This stops moisture-laden air from getting to the surface of your window.

Comfortable Increased
Double glazing creates an air barrier, helping to hold heat and prevent freezing temperatures from affecting your house. This means that you'll not have to depend on your central heating as much in the winter months, which can save on your energy bills.
The gap between the two panes of glass is filled with an insulating gas, which can improve the energy efficiency of your home. Double glazing's insulation qualities also reduce noise pollution, which results in a more relaxing and peaceful home.
